Understanding the Unique Diet for Cystic Fibrosis Patients with Diabetes

4 min read

Approximately 40–50% of adults and 20% of adolescents with cystic fibrosis (CF) will develop cystic fibrosis-related diabetes (CFRD). Unlike other forms of diabetes, managing CFRD requires a unique approach that prioritizes high-calorie and high-fat intake while carefully balancing carbohydrate intake with insulin to support overall health and weight maintenance.

Why the Diet for CFRD is Different

For individuals with CF, maintaining a high body weight is crucial for better lung function and overall health. CFRD develops due to damage to the pancreas, which affects both insulin production and the ability to absorb fats and nutrients effectively. This creates a dietary challenge that contrasts sharply with the low-fat, low-sugar advice typically given to people with Type 1 or Type 2 diabetes. Instead, the nutritional goal is to provide high energy and nutrients to prevent malnutrition and weight loss while carefully matching insulin to food intake to prevent hyperglycemia.

The Core Principles of a CFRD Diet

  • High-Calorie and High-Fat Intake: To counteract malabsorption and meet increased energy demands from constant breathing effort and fighting infections, a high-calorie and high-fat diet is essential. This means incorporating healthy fats like olive oil, avocado, nuts, and seeds into meals.
  • Adequate Protein: Higher protein requirements are common due to inflammation and respiratory distress. Protein sources such as lean meats, poultry, fish, eggs, and dairy products are vital.
  • Carbohydrate Counting: Carbohydrates affect blood glucose levels most significantly. Patients with CFRD are taught carbohydrate counting to match their insulin dose precisely to their food intake. This allows for dietary flexibility without compromising blood sugar control.
  • Regular Meals and Snacks: Eating regular meals and snacks is important to provide a constant source of fuel and avoid large blood sugar fluctuations. Some CF teams recommend a high-carbohydrate bedtime snack to prevent nighttime hypoglycemia.
  • Pancreatic Enzyme Replacement Therapy (PERT): Proper adherence to PERT is non-negotiable for those with pancreatic insufficiency. Enzymes must be taken with meals and snacks to ensure the body can absorb the fat, protein, and fat-soluble vitamins (A, D, E, K) necessary for health.

Daily Meal and Snack Considerations

A typical day on a CFRD diet might include three balanced meals and several high-calorie snacks. Nutritional supplements or high-calorie drinks may also be used to meet energy needs.

Example meal ideas:

  • Breakfast: Oatmeal made with full-fat milk and enriched with nuts, seeds, and a scoop of protein powder.
  • Lunch: A sandwich on whole-grain bread with lean meat, avocado, cheese, and a side of mixed nuts.
  • Dinner: Baked salmon with roasted sweet potatoes and broccoli, drizzled with olive oil.
  • Snacks: Full-fat yogurt with berries, cheese and crackers, or a homemade milkshake with ice cream and milk powder.

Comparison: CFRD Diet vs. Standard Diabetes Diet

The table below highlights the key differences in nutritional recommendations for people with cystic fibrosis-related diabetes compared to those with standard Type 1 or Type 2 diabetes.

Feature Cystic Fibrosis-Related Diabetes (CFRD) Standard Diabetes (Type 1 or 2)
Primary Goal Prevent malnutrition, maintain weight, and control blood glucose. Control blood glucose and manage weight to prevent complications.
Calorie Intake High-calorie to meet increased energy needs. Often a restricted-calorie diet to manage weight.
Fat Intake High-fat, focusing on healthy fats, is encouraged. Typically a low-fat diet to prevent heart disease.
Carbohydrate Management Count carbs to match insulin dosage, but don't restrict total carb intake. Manage total carbohydrate intake and limit simple sugars.
Sugar Intake Simple sugars can be included, especially to treat hypoglycemia, but very sugary drinks should be used with caution. Simple sugars are often highly restricted or avoided.
Insulin Therapy Essential and dosed to cover high food intake. Dosed to match moderate food intake and manage blood sugar levels.

Advanced Strategies for Managing CFRD

  • Personalized Carbohydrate Counting: Not all carbohydrates affect blood sugar at the same rate. Working with a dietitian to understand the glycemic index (GI) of different foods can help fine-tune insulin doses to match meals.
  • Management During Illness: Infection or illness, such as a chest exacerbation, often increases blood sugar levels. Patients may need extra insulin and more frequent glucose monitoring, while ensuring they continue to consume adequate calories and fluids.
  • Impact of CFTR Modulators: Newer CFTR modulator therapies have improved nutritional status and weight in many patients. This can alter energy needs, and some patients may need to adjust their calorie or fat intake to prevent unwanted weight gain. Regular consultation with the CF care team is vital to adapt the diet as health status changes.
  • Exercise Management: Regular physical activity improves the body's response to insulin. Patients should coordinate with their care team to adjust food and insulin for exercise to prevent hypoglycemia.
